coregl_fastpath: Fix some issue in core_fastpath_gl.c 36/83136/2
authorZhaowei Yuan <zhaowei.yuan@samsung.com>
Mon, 8 Aug 2016 20:34:17 +0000 (04:34 +0800)
committerzhaowei yuan <zhaowei.yuan@samsung.com>
Tue, 9 Aug 2016 08:39:49 +0000 (01:39 -0700)
Modification includes:
1. Add process for missed target
2. Pass real object to GL driver
3. Convert output parameters as needed
